A floating rib prevents point of impact shifts caused by barrel heating as it allows the rib and barrel to expand independently. The firing pins (#21) are spring loaded (#22) and are interchangeable from one barrel to the other. That adds weight and increases the height of the receiver, so Brownings engineers decided to switch to an innovative new Monolock hinge that has dual lumps that fit into channels in the Monolock. Back-Bored Technology is standard on A5, Maxus, BT-99 and on 12 and 20 gauge Citori 725, Citori, Cynergy, BPS and Silver models. The MonoLock Hinge is the integration of the monoblock and the hinge and this combination has up to 300% more surface area to pivot on than traditional trunnion-style hinges. Store.
